The Evolution of the Dual Sport Legend

Honda has once again turned heads in the dual sport world with the unveiling of their upgraded CRF300L and CRF300 Rally for 2025. These machines are not just carrying on the legacy; they’re elevating it to new heights. For riders who cherish versatility in their adventures, the CRF300 series has always been a top contender, fitting seamlessly into both urban commuting and rugged off-road escapades.

What’s New in 2025?

The 2025 models come packed with enhancements that make them more appealing than ever. With a refined engine offering improved power delivery and responsiveness, riders will feel the thrill of acceleration like never before. Plus, the ergonomic updates to the seat and handlebars provide a more comfortable ride, whether you’re tackling tough trails or cruising down city streets.
